JAKARTA - Phil Collins was seen in public again after several years of facing health problems. The legendary musician was present at Buckingham Palace wearing crutches during the 50th anniversary of The King's Trust.
According to a report by The Mirror, quoted on Monday, May 18, Collins, 75, posed with Sir Rod Stewart, Jill Collins, and Penny Lancaster. He was wearing a black suit and a red tie.
The event was held to commemorate the 50th anniversary of King Charles' charity, The King's Trust, which was previously called The Prince's Trust. A number of famous figures attended, including Benedict Cumberbatch, Idris Elba, George Clooney, and Amal Clooney.
Collins' appearance attracted attention because he rarely appears in public. He was diagnosed with severe pancreatitis, an inflammation of the pancreas that can cause serious complications.
Collins also suffered a spinal injury while on tour with Genesis in 2007. The injury triggered nerve damage in his hands and feet, causing him to stop playing drums and retire from touring in 2022.
In addition, he underwent knee surgery, suffered from type 2 diabetes, and experienced hearing loss due to a viral infection in 2000.
In an interview with Zoe Ball in February, Collins called the past two years a difficult and frustrating time.
He also spoke openly about his alcohol drinking habits which had worsened while living alone in Switzerland after his divorce from Orianne Cevey.
"I'm not the type of person who stays up all night to drink. I drink during the day. But I guess I drank too much and eventually it all caught up with me," he said, quoted by The Mirror.
Although now he has to walk with crutches, Collins has not closed the door to making music again. He said he still has a number of unfinished materials and opens the opportunity to return to the recording studio.
"I've had five operations on my knee. But now I have a functioning knee and I can walk, albeit with crutches. But I'm not dead yet," he said.
Phil Collins is known as one of the big names in pop and rock music in the world. He collected three number one singles in the UK, two Golden Globes, six Brit Awards, and eight Grammy Awards.
Offstage, Collins was married three times. The cost of settling his divorce was reported to be 42 million pounds sterling.
He has five children, including actress Lily Collins, star of Emily in Paris, as well as Nicholas Collins who plays drums and once replaced his father Phil Collins in Genesis.
Collins said he was still proud of his children and his long journey in the music world.
"I want to do it again. I wouldn't miss it for anything," he said.
